Ben Arikian (62nd minute) and Michael Todd (90th minute) had unassisted goals as the host Long Island Rough Riders shut out the New Jersey Rangers, 2-0, in United Soccer Leagues Premier Development League action at St. Anthony's High School Saturday.
The Rough Riders lead the Eastern Conference, Northeast Division with a 7-1-0 record and 21 points and are tied with the Western Conference, Southwest Division's Hollywood United Hitmen for the best record in the PDL this season. Long Island travels to the Rhode Island Stingrays this Saturday.
The Rangers (1-4-1, four points) are tied with the New Hampshire Phantoms (1-6-1) for last place in the division and meet Saturday at Rhode Island College.
